In which the vast and vividly described Tartar camp presents a striking tableau of diverse peoples and uneasy prisoners amid the unfolding turmoil of Siberia’s invasion, where Michael Strogoff remains resolute despite captivity. Meanwhile, the hopes and plans of two correspondents intersect with the dark shadow cast by Ivan Ogareff’s anticipated arrival, weaving a tense atmosphere of impending events.
